In an endothermic reaction would energy be considered a reactant or a product?

Respuesta :

Ghostplayzyt1
Ghostplayzyt1 Ghostplayzyt1
  • 03-04-2020

Answer:

In an endothermic reaction, the products have more stored chemical energy than the reactants. In an exothermic reaction, the opposite is true. The products have less stored chemical energy than the reactants. The excess energy in the reactants is released to the surroundings
